Quality Assurance Analysts - REMOTE
HHS Technology Group, Inc., Atlanta, GA, United States
WHO WE ARE:
At HHS Tech Group (HTG), our work matters, and each of us makes a difference in the lives of people every day.
HTG is a leader in the development and delivery of innovative, purpose-built modular software and technology solutions to clients in the commercial and government sectors.
WHAT WE DO:
HHS Tech Group creates innovative, purpose-built technology products and solutions, resulting in value and positive, quantifiable impact for our clients and the people they serve.
Our people bring our software to life through collaborative relationships with our clients, working as a team, helping to solve complex problems that create positive personal and community impact for the people our clients serve.
Each day, our software products and our people are making a difference.
OUR PEOPLE MATTER MOST:
Improving the lives of others and making an impact daily is no simple task. We are dedicated to our team's professional and personal growth and well-being. Some key rewards and benefits include:
- Generously sponsored Medical Insurance
- Fully paid premiums on dental, vision, life, and disability insurance.
- Generous 401k matching program (100% match up to 6%)
- Tuition and Certification reimbursement
- Open PTO policy
Join us!
WHO WE ARE HIRING: Quality Assurance Analysts
HHS Technology Group is seeking a Quality Assurance Analysts to work on the Electronic Licensing System (ELS) project in partnership with the Minnesota Department of Information Technology Services (MNIT) partnering with the Department of Natural Resources (DNR)
The QA Analysts will provide support to the DNR ELS lead quality assurance/business analyst throughout the implementation of a new State solution. The QAA will engage in testing and create any related QA artifacts for ELS. These requirements and artifacts will be used throughout the implementation of the ELS project. This will be done in conjunction with State or contract Business and Quality Assurance Analysts and Project Managers. These QAAs will work directly with both DNR and MNIT DNR staff to perform quality assurance activities throughout the software development lifecycle.
WHAT YOU WILL DO:
At a high level, the QAAs will work as part of a team to test vendor developed software products for the DNR's ELS. This is a multi-year project with multiple releases.
The delivery of the work will follow the DNR standards, processes, and procedures. Actively participate in the Agile events implemented by the development team (MNIT, DNR, Vendor) and collaborate with team members. The work is expected to be done remotely. If the resource(s) are local, there will be opportunities to join the team onsite.
Responsibilities:
• Participate in formal review of business/functional requirements and application design
• Prepare a Test Plan
• Determine the types of testing that will be executed
• Design and document test cases and scripts (manual and/or automated)
• Identify and communicate test requirements
• Establish testing entrance and exit criteria
• Identify and prepare test data
• Execute manual and/or automated test scripts for complex projects.
• Analyze, report, help troubleshoot and resolve test failures
• Report overall test status and results
• Report and log defects found as a result of the test execution
• Perform other testing tasks as may be required by the project
• Provide knowledge transfer
- Review functional requirements
- Create technical design documents
- Transform software designs and specifications into secure, high functioning code in Java and document solutions
- Integrate individual software solutions to applicable systems
- Test code periodically to ensure it produces the desirable results and perform debugging when necessary
- Perform upgrades to make software and systems more secure and efficient
- Communicate and incorporate business owner's visions, business plans, and key objectives
- Provide updates as required for MNIT, MNsure and DHS leadership
- Provide development and related operations, maintenance, and production support
- Foster a culture that supports and drives staff engagement and collaboration in support of State objectives
- Establish, manage, and leverage business and technology relationships both internal and external
- Provide knowledge transfer
Minimum Requirements:
- Five (5) years' of Quality Assurance work creating and executing manual test cases/test scripts from scratch.
- Experience with Software development lifecycle methodologies including agile and the Scrum framework as a team member.
- Experience writing and executing both positive (happy path) and negative (e.g. boundary, input validation, exception (error validation) test cases.
- Experience in collaborative teamwork, establishing/maintaining working relationships with business customers and technology staff, while concurrently providing technical leadership in planning, designing, executing tests, mentoring, and developing procedures for product quality on complex projects utilizing industry-standard software development methodologies.
- Experience in multiple programming languages, software development technologies, and diverse database platforms, with hands-on experience in working with web-based forms, web-based content, interactive solutions, and conducting testing on web-based applications, web services, and database systems.
- Experience on large, complex implementations with 3rd party vendors.
- Experience in utilizing DevOps tools such as Jira for streamlined software development, continuous integration, and deployment processes.
- Experience with security, accessibility, performance, and stress testing.
- Ability to communicate clearly, present complex information to users in a comprehensive style, translate technical, and system information for non-technical stakeholders.
- SQL experience